Burn bans for Allen, Caddo, Jeff Davis parishes


A burn ban has been set for Allen Parish by its Police Jury, except for prescribed burns by the Louisiana Department of Agriculture & Forestry.


The Police Jury ban prohibits burning trash and vegetation and any other open burning for about a month. Projectile fireworks also are included in the ban, except for public firework displays for the next 30 days. The burn ban will remain until Policy Jury action rescinds it.


Jefferson Davis Parish Police Jury also has established a burn ban until further notice.


JDPPJ ordered no burning of trash or vegetation or any open burning. It also prohibits discharging any kind of fireworks.


Caddo Parish in Northwest Louisiana is the only other parish establishing burn bans, according to the LDAF website.
